[0027] In order to solve the problem that the method for determining the precoding vector provided by the prior art consumes more computing resources, the inventor has performed the following analysis on the method for determining the precoding vector provided by the prior art:

[0028] The precoding based on SVD decomposition is optimal, but the calculation amount of a typical SVD solution algorithm (which usually requires iteration) increases with the increase of the matrix dimension. In the case of a large number of transmitting antennas but a small number of transmission streams (in the LTE Rel.8 / 9 / 10 specification, single-stream and dual-stream transmission modes are specifically defined, and in the multi-user terminal transmission mode, each UE The number of transport streams does not exceed 2), and complete SVD decomposition is not necessary, because only the right singular vector corresponding to the largest n singular values ​​is needed. The invention discloses a pre-coded vector determination method, a pre-coded vector determination device, a base station and a user terminal, aiming at solving the problem that many computing resources are consumed by adopting the existing pre-coded vector determination method. The method comprises the steps of: determining equivalent channel matrixes T<j> of all user terminals, and aiming at each user terminal, executing the following steps of: according to the T<j> of other user terminals, determining an interference channel matrix and executing orthogonalization processing to all row vectors in the interference channel matrix to obtain a group of standard orthogonal bases B; determining an orthogonal projection matrix of a subspace which is formed from the equivalent channel matrix of the user terminal to the interference channel matrix in a spanning way, determining the quantity of receiving antennas of the user terminal, taking the orthogonal projection matrix as a matrix to be conducted with singular value decomposition (SVD), and according to a preset corresponding relation between the quantity of the receiving antennas and simplified SVD algorithms, determining a simplified SVD algorithm corresponding to the determined quantity of the receiving antennas; and according to a right singular vector corresponding to a singular value determined based on the determined simplified SVD algorithm, determining a pre-coded vector aiming at the user terminal.

technical field [0001] The present invention relates to the technical field of wireless communication, in particular to a method and device for determining a precoding vector, a base station and a user terminal. Background technique [0002] The downlink transmission scheme based on precoding is one of the core transmission schemes of the multi-antenna system. The so-called precoding means that the base station multiplies the information symbols to be transmitted by a precoding vector, and the elements in the precoding vector have a one-to-one correspondence relationship with the transmitting antennas. The precoding vector is usually obtained based on Singular Value Decomposition (SVD, Singular Value Decomposition), that is, performing SVD decomposition on the downlink Multiple-Input Multiple-Output (MIMO, Multiple-Input Multiple-Out-put) channel matrix H.
